Ordinals
beta
Sat 853833014736561
decimal
170766.3014736561
degree
0°170766′1422″3014736561‴
percentile
40.65871503217989%
name
humkxjlyama
cycle
0
epoch
0
period
84
block
170766
offset
3014736561
timestamp
2012-03-12 04:44:52 UTC
rarity
common
prev
next